# Copyright 1999-2014 Gentoo Foundation
#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
# $Header: $
EAPI=2
inherit fortran-2 toolchain-funcs versionator
MY_P="${P/-/}"
DESCRIPTION="Model-independent Parameter ESTimation for calibration and predictive uncertainty analysis"
HOMEPAGE="http://www.pesthomepage.org/"
SRC_URI="
http://www.pesthomepage.org/getfiles.php?file=${MY_P}.tar.zip -> ${P}.tar.zip
doc? (
http://www.pesthomepage.org/files/pestman.pdf
http://www.pesthomepage.org/files/addendum.pdf )"
# License is poorly specified on the SSPA web site. It only says that
# Pest is freeware.
LICENSE="public-domain"
SLOT="0"
KEYWORDS="~amd64"
IUSE="doc"
DEPEND="app-arch/unzip"
RDEPEND=""
FORTRAN_STANDARD="90"
MAKEOPTS="${MAKEOPTS} -j1"
S="${WORKDIR}/${PN}"
src_unpack() {
mkdir "${S}" && cd "${S}"
unpack "${P}.tar.zip"
unpack ./"${MY_P}.tar"
}
src_prepare() {
# I decided it was cleaner to make all edits with sed, rather than a patch.
sed -i \
-e "s;^F90=.*;F90=$(tc-getFC);" \
-e "s;^LD=.*;LD=$(tc-getFC);" \
*.mak makefile
sed -i \
-e "s;^FFLAGS=.*;FFLAGS=${FFLAGS:--O2} -c;" \
*.mak
sed -i \
-e "s;^INSTALLDIR=.*;INSTALLDIR=${D}/usr/bin;" \
-e 's;^install :;install :\n\tinstall -d $(INSTALLDIR);' \
makefile
}
src_compile() {
emake cppp || die "cppp emake failed"
for mfile in pest.mak ppest.mak pestutl1.mak pestutl2.mak pestutl3.mak pestutl4.mak pestutl5.mak pestutl6.mak sensan.mak mpest.mak
do
emake -f ${mfile} all || die "${mfile} emake failed"
done
}
src_install() {
emake install || die "emake install failed"
if use doc ; then
dodoc "${DISTDIR}"/pestman.pdf
dodoc "${DISTDIR}"/addendum.pdf
fi
}
src_test() {
ebegin "Running d_test"
make d_test || die "make d_test failed"
eend $?
}
